Abstract
859. Taylor, J. Jan. 13. Incandescent gas lamps.-A support for mantles consists of a plate or ring a, shown in plan in Fig. 1 and in section in Fig. 2, with holes c in the cross-bar b to receive the forked end of the usual support. The ring and forked support may be made in one piece, as shown in Fig. 5.
